Oil majors affected by OPEC+ output hike, not from U.S. tariffs, Eni exec says


CERNOBBIO, Italy (Reuters) – Oil majors are struggling after eight OPEC+ international locations unexpectedly agreed to extend oil output in Could, whereas tariffs imposed by U.S. administration had a muted impact on the sector, Eni’s high govt Francesco Gattei stated on Friday.

He added that vitality teams might react to the potential for tariffs denting world financial development, lowering demand for energy.

The precise improve in OPEC+ manufacturing might outcome decrease than introduced when bearing in mind a stricter U.S. embargo on Venezuela and the potential drop in Kazakhstan’s oil flows, Gattei added, talking on the sidelines of a enterprise convention.
